Shillong heartbroken over Idol miss
Text: John W Thabah in Shillong | Photographs: Sanjib Bhattacharjee
It's finally over. When the Indian Idol winner was announced on Sunday, September 23, Shillong's dream was shattered, and people dispersed from the places where giant screens were put up in tears and despair.
Amit Paul, a 24 year old boy from the city who many hoped and prayed would become the winner of Sony Entertainment Television's Indian Idol lost to his rival Prashant Tamang of Darjeeling.
"I am very sad," says Alva Moreen Shadap, a teenager from Mawlai who has been voting for Amit since day one. "I don't know whether I can sleep and forget what has happened," she adds.
